Nepalese Premier leaves for New Delhi on maiden visit to India
Kathmandu, Aug 18 (PTI) Nepalese Premier Madhav Kumar
Nepal Tuesday left for New Delhi on a five-day maiden official
visit during which he will discuss issues of mutual interest
with Indians leaders including his counterpart Manmohan Singh.
During the bilateral meeting with Singh, Nepal is
expected to discuss a host of issues, including extradition
treaty, the review of the 1950 Peace and Friendship Treaty,
Bhutanese refugee problem, Nepal's peace process and matters
relating to security and border.
Nepal, who is leading a 64-strong delegation, is
accompanied by Finance, Tourism, Commerce, Industry and Energy
ministers. However, Foreign Minister Sujata Koirala was unable
to join the delegation citing health reasons. PTI
